Tom Holland is 23. At that age, there isn’t much “dramatic” aging as long as you take care of yourself. At 13, no matter what you do there will be dramatic aging between 13 and 15, for example. Tom is well past that stage of development.

Things haven’t been announced yet, but I think that it’s pretty clear that Sony is going to want a Spidey movie at least every two years, and Marvel is going to want to keep their arrangement and meet that timeline because it is good for the MCU.

I think it is very likely that Marvel will have to continue this story with not too much time in between Far From Home and “MCU Spidey 3”. Even if it is 2 years in the “real world”. Next year, what is likely in the MCU? Black Widow and Eternals, right? One is a prequel and the other is either off world and/or a prequel of sorts.

Shang-Chi isn’t likely to intersect with “modern day”
New York. Black Panther 2, Guardians 3, etc.. aren’t going to intersect with modern day New York. I’m not sure I see much else coming out within the next 2 years that will focus on “present day New York” other than Doctor Strange 2, and even that will likely be focused on its own thing. So I don’t see any reason why Spidey 3 can’t come out in 2021 and pick up pretty closely from the end of Far From Home.
